[SCSI] convert to the new PM framework
This patch (as1397b) converts the SCSI midlayer to use the new PM callbacks (struct dev_pm_ops). A new source file, scsi_pm.c, is created to hold the new callback routines, and the existing suspend/resume code is moved there. 1/*
2 * scsi_pm.c Copyright (C) 2010 Alan Stern
3 *
4 * SCSI dynamic Power Management
5 * Initial version: Alan Stern <stern@rowland.harvard.edu>
6 */
7
8#include <linux/pm_runtime.h>
9
10#include <scsi/scsi.h>
11#include <scsi/scsi_device.h>
12#include <scsi/scsi_driver.h>
13#include <scsi/scsi_host.h>
14
15#include "scsi_priv.h"
16
17static int scsi_dev_type_suspend(struct device *dev, pm_message_t msg)
18{
19 struct device_driver *drv;
20 int err;
21
22 err = scsi_device_quiesce(to_scsi_device(dev));
23 if (err == 0) {
24 drv = dev->driver;
25 if (drv && drv->suspend)
26 err = drv->suspend(dev, msg);
27 }
28 dev_dbg(dev, "scsi suspend: %d\n", err);
29 return err;
30}
31
32static int scsi_dev_type_resume(struct device *dev)
33{
34 struct device_driver *drv;
35 int err = 0;
36
37 drv = dev->driver;
38 if (drv && drv->resume)
39 err = drv->resume(dev);
40 scsi_device_resume(to_scsi_device(dev));
41 dev_dbg(dev, "scsi resume: %d\n", err);
42 return err;
43}
44
45#ifdef CONFIG_PM_SLEEP
46
47static int scsi_bus_suspend_common(struct device *dev, pm_message_t msg)
48{
49 int err = 0;
50
51 if (scsi_is_sdev_device(dev))
52 err = scsi_dev_type_suspend(dev, msg);
53 return err;
54}
55
56static int scsi_bus_resume_common(struct device *dev)
57{
58 int err = 0;
59
60 if (scsi_is_sdev_device(dev))
61 err = scsi_dev_type_resume(dev);
62 return err;
63}
64
65static int scsi_bus_suspend(struct device *dev)
66{
67 return scsi_bus_suspend_common(dev, PMSG_SUSPEND);
68}
69
70static int scsi_bus_freeze(struct device *dev)
71{
72 return scsi_bus_suspend_common(dev, PMSG_FREEZE);
73}
74
75static int scsi_bus_poweroff(struct device *dev)
76{
77 return scsi_bus_suspend_common(dev, PMSG_HIBERNATE);
78}
79
80#else /* CONFIG_PM_SLEEP */
81
82#define scsi_bus_resume_common NULL
83#define scsi_bus_suspend NULL
84#define scsi_bus_freeze NULL
85#define scsi_bus_poweroff NULL
86
87#endif /* CONFIG_PM_SLEEP */
88
89const struct dev_pm_ops scsi_bus_pm_ops = {
90 .suspend = scsi_bus_suspend,
91 .resume = scsi_bus_resume_common,
92 .freeze = scsi_bus_freeze,
93 .thaw = scsi_bus_resume_common,
94 .poweroff = scsi_bus_poweroff,
95 .restore = scsi_bus_resume_common,
96};
